1. Jack & Ginger Beer

Hard to pass up a classic refreshing bevvy like a Jack & Ginger. Just rolls off the tongue, quite literally as you sip it while poolside or with some mates. Here’s how to get it done:

  • 30ml Jack Daniel’s Old No.7
  • Bundaberg Ginger Beer
  • Lime
  • Ice

Add ice and 30ml to a high glass, top with ginger beer and a squeeze of lime (or if you’re as lazy as I am, just open a Jack & Ginger Beer RTD and skip the mixing).

2. Finlandia Grapefruit & Soda

One of the absolute easiest drinks to indulge in on the list, it’s a tarty little bevvy that’ll have you feeling summery even after the sun’s down. Here’s how to make it:

  • 30ml of Finlandia Grapefruit
  • Soda Water
  • Ice

Add ice and 30ml of Finlandia Grapefruit to a high glass, then top with soda water. Seriously, it’s that easy. This is a drink you can knock up in no time flat and be back to the banter in seconds.

3. French Martini

Fancy and pink-toned. Think of it as James Bond but with a summer twist – and let nobody tell you it’s not manly to drink pink. Make it like this:

  • 20ml Chambord
  • 40ml Finlandia Vodka
  • 60ml Pineapple Juice

Take a shaker filled with ice. Add the Chambord, vodka and pineapple juice, then give it your best shake – no really, an enthusiastic one. Then just pour.

4. Lynchburg Lemonade

Love a little alliteration, I do. And you gotta love a drink that’s only three ingredients but tastes as fancy as if it had twelve. If you’re keen on giving it a whirl, here’s how:

  • 30ml of Jack Daniel’s Old No 7
  • 15ml of triple sec to a highball glass.
  • Lemonade to fill

Fill with ice, top up with lemonade and a squeeze of fresh lemon. Gotta get that zest into you somehow; after all, it’s summer and summer is the time for lemonade.

5. Jägermeister & Tonic

You probably fall into one of two categories: you love Jäger, or you cannot abide it. If you’re the former, this is a heck of a way to have it. Make it like this:

  • 40ml of Jägermeister
  • Tonic water to fill
  • Lime/lemon/orange zest

Start with a coupla cubes of ice in your glass (two or three is plenty) and douse them with 40ml of Jägermeister. Fill up the rest with your all-time fave tonic water and garnish with a curl of lime, lemon or orange zest – you know, for a bit of colour and excitement.
